DIY Printed Circuit Board Guide

Posted by

Introduction to Printed Circuit Boards (PCBs)

Printed Circuit Boards, commonly known as PCBs, are the backbone of modern electronics. These boards are used to mechanically support and electrically connect electronic components using conductive pathways, tracks, or signal traces etched from copper sheets laminated onto a non-conductive substrate. PCBs have revolutionized the electronics industry by providing a reliable and efficient way to mass-produce electronic devices.

In this comprehensive guide, we will walk you through the process of designing and manufacturing your own PCBs. Whether you are an electronics enthusiast, a hobbyist, or a professional, this guide will provide you with the knowledge and tools necessary to create custom PCBs for your projects.

Advantages of PCBs

PCBs offer several advantages over traditional point-to-point wiring and breadboard prototyping:

  1. Reliability: PCBs provide a stable and durable platform for electronic components, reducing the risk of loose connections and short circuits.
  2. Miniaturization: PCBs allow for the compact placement of components, enabling the creation of smaller and more portable devices.
  3. Mass production: Once a PCB design is finalized, it can be easily replicated for mass production, reducing manufacturing costs and time.
  4. Improved signal integrity: PCBs offer better signal integrity compared to other wiring methods, as the copper traces are designed to minimize electromagnetic interference and crosstalk.

PCB Design Process

The PCB design process involves several steps, from concept to the final product. Let’s explore each step in detail.

Step 1: Schematic Design

The first step in designing a PCB is to create a schematic diagram. A schematic is a graphical representation of the electronic circuit, showing the components and their interconnections. To create a schematic, you can use Electronic Design Automation (EDA) software such as KiCad, Eagle, or Altium Designer.

When designing your schematic, consider the following:

  1. Choose the appropriate components for your circuit based on their specifications and ratings.
  2. Ensure that the components are properly connected, following the circuit diagram.
  3. Use appropriate symbols and labels for clarity and ease of understanding.
  4. Perform a design review to catch any errors or inconsistencies before proceeding to the next step.

Step 2: Component Placement

Once your schematic is complete, you can move on to the component placement stage. This involves arranging the components on the PCB layout in a logical and efficient manner. Consider the following factors when placing components:

  1. Component size and shape: Ensure that the components fit within the available space on the PCB.
  2. Thermal considerations: Place heat-generating components, such as power regulators, away from temperature-sensitive components.
  3. Signal integrity: Position critical components, such as high-speed digital ICs, close to their associated components to minimize signal degradation.
  4. Manufacturing constraints: Adhere to the design rules specified by your PCB manufacturer, such as minimum clearances and drill sizes.

Step 3: Routing

After placing the components, you need to route the traces that connect them. Routing is the process of creating the conductive paths on the PCB that carry signals and power between components. When routing your PCB, keep the following in mind:

  1. Signal integrity: Minimize the length of critical signal traces to reduce signal degradation and electromagnetic interference.
  2. Power distribution: Provide adequate power and ground connections to all components, using wider traces for high-current paths.
  3. Electromagnetic compatibility (EMC): Follow best practices for EMC, such as proper grounding, shielding, and filtering, to minimize electromagnetic interference.
  4. Manufacturing constraints: Adhere to the minimum trace width and spacing requirements specified by your PCB manufacturer.

Step 4: Design Rule Check (DRC)

Before finalizing your PCB layout, perform a Design Rule Check (DRC) to ensure that your design meets the manufacturing constraints and design rules. DRC tools, available in most EDA software, will check your layout for potential issues such as:

  1. Minimum trace width and spacing violations
  2. Insufficient clearances between components and traces
  3. Unconnected or shorted nets
  4. Incorrect hole sizes or spacing

Resolve any DRC errors or warnings before proceeding to the next step.

Step 5: Gerber File Generation

Once your PCB layout is complete and has passed the DRC, you need to generate Gerber files. Gerber files are the industry-standard format for describing the layout of a PCB, including the copper layers, solder mask, and silkscreen. Most EDA software can generate Gerber files automatically.

When generating Gerber files, ensure that you include all the necessary layers, such as:

  1. Top and bottom copper layers
  2. Solder mask layers
  3. Silkscreen layers
  4. Drill files

PCB Manufacturing Process

With your Gerber files ready, you can now send them to a PCB manufacturer for fabrication. The PCB manufacturing process involves several steps, which we will discuss in this section.

Step 1: PCB Fabrication

PCB fabrication begins with the creation of a copper-clad laminate, which consists of a non-conductive substrate (usually FR-4) bonded with a thin layer of copper on one or both sides. The Gerber files are used to create photomasks, which are then used to transfer the PCB layout onto the copper-clad laminate through a photolithography process.

The photolithography process involves the following steps:

  1. Cleaning: The copper-clad laminate is cleaned to remove any contaminants.
  2. Photoresist application: A light-sensitive polymer, called photoresist, is applied to the copper surface.
  3. Exposure: The photomask is placed on top of the photoresist-coated laminate, and UV light is used to expose the resist, hardening the areas not covered by the mask.
  4. Developing: The unexposed photoresist is removed using a chemical developer, leaving behind the hardened resist in the desired pattern.

After photolithography, the PCB undergoes the following processes:

  1. Etching: The exposed copper is removed using a chemical etchant, leaving behind the desired copper traces.
  2. Stripping: The remaining photoresist is stripped away, revealing the final copper pattern.
  3. Drilling: Holes are drilled through the PCB for through-hole components and vias.
  4. Plating: The drilled holes are plated with copper to ensure electrical conductivity between layers.
  5. Solder mask application: A protective solder mask is applied to the PCB, covering the copper traces while leaving the pads exposed.
  6. Silkscreen printing: Text and symbols are printed on the PCB using silkscreen ink for component labeling and identification.

Step 2: PCB Assembly

After the PCB fabrication is complete, the components are mounted onto the board. There are two main methods for PCB assembly: through-hole and surface mount.

  1. Through-hole assembly: Components with long leads are inserted through holes drilled in the PCB and soldered on the opposite side.
  2. Surface mount assembly: Components are mounted directly onto the surface of the PCB using solder paste and a reflow oven.

The choice between through-hole and surface mount assembly depends on the components used, the available space on the PCB, and the manufacturing capabilities.

Step 3: Quality Control

After the PCB assembly is complete, the board undergoes various quality control checks to ensure proper functionality and reliability. These checks may include:

  1. Visual inspection: The PCB is visually inspected for any defects, such as solder bridges, missing components, or incorrect component placement.
  2. Automated Optical Inspection (AOI): An automated camera system checks the PCB for any assembly defects.
  3. X-ray inspection: X-ray imaging is used to inspect solder joints and other hidden features.
  4. Electrical testing: The PCB is powered on and tested for proper functionality using a test fixture or a Bed-of-Nails Tester.
  5. Burn-in testing: The PCB is subjected to a period of continuous operation at elevated temperatures to identify any early failures.

PCB Design and Manufacturing Tips

To ensure a successful PCB design and manufacturing process, consider the following tips:

  1. Start with a clear and well-defined schematic to avoid design errors and inconsistencies.
  2. Choose components that are readily available and have a reliable supply chain to avoid delays in manufacturing.
  3. Follow the design rules and guidelines provided by your PCB manufacturer to minimize the risk of fabrication issues.
  4. Use a consistent and clear naming convention for your components, nets, and layers to make your design easier to understand and maintain.
  5. Perform thorough design reviews and DRCs to catch any errors early in the design process.
  6. Consider the mechanical aspects of your PCB, such as mounting holes, connectors, and enclosures, to ensure proper fitment and functionality.
  7. Work closely with your PCB manufacturer and assembly partner to ensure clear communication and to address any issues promptly.

Frequently Asked Questions (FAQ)

What software can I use to design PCBs?

There are several Electronic Design Automation (EDA) software packages available for PCB design, including:

  1. KiCad (free and open-source)
  2. Autodesk Eagle (free for small projects)
  3. Altium Designer (paid)
  4. Cadence OrCAD (paid)
  5. Mentor Graphics PADS (paid)

Choose the software that best suits your needs, budget, and experience level.

How much does it cost to manufacture a PCB?

The cost of manufacturing a PCB depends on several factors, such as:

  1. PCB size and complexity
  2. Number of layers
  3. Material selection
  4. Surface finish
  5. Quantity ordered

Generally, the cost per PCB decreases as the quantity increases. For small quantities (1-10 boards), expect to pay anywhere from $10 to $100 per board, depending on the complexity and specifications.

What are the different types of PCBs?

PCBs can be classified based on the number of layers and the material used:

  1. Single-sided PCBs: Copper traces on one side of the substrate, suitable for simple circuits.
  2. Double-sided PCBs: Copper traces on both sides of the substrate, with through-hole connections between layers.
  3. Multi-layer PCBs: Three or more layers of copper traces, separated by insulating layers, for complex circuits and high-density designs.
  4. Flexible PCBs: Made from flexible materials, such as polyimide, for applications that require bending or folding.
  5. Rigid-Flex PCBs: A combination of rigid and flexible sections, for devices that require both structural support and flexibility.

What are the common PCB materials?

The most common PCB materials are:

  1. FR-4: A flame-retardant, glass-reinforced epoxy laminate, widely used for its low cost and good mechanical and electrical properties.
  2. High-Tg FR-4: A variant of FR-4 with improved thermal stability, suitable for high-temperature applications.
  3. Polyimide: A flexible, heat-resistant material used for flexible PCBs and high-temperature applications.
  4. PTFE (Teflon): A low-dielectric-constant material used for high-frequency and microwave applications.
  5. Aluminum: Used as a substrate for PCBs that require high thermal conductivity, such as LED lighting and power electronics.

How long does it take to manufacture a PCB?

The lead time for PCB manufacturing depends on the complexity of the design, the chosen manufacturer, and the quantity ordered. Typical lead times range from 1-2 weeks for standard designs to several weeks for complex, high-layer-count boards. Rush services are available from some manufacturers, but they come at a premium cost.


Designing and manufacturing your own PCBs can be a rewarding and educational experience. By following the steps and guidelines outlined in this guide, you can create custom PCBs for your electronics projects, whether you are a hobbyist or a professional.

Remember to start with a clear schematic, follow best practices for component placement and routing, and work closely with your PCB manufacturer to ensure a successful outcome. With practice and persistence, you will be able to design and manufacture high-quality PCBs that meet your project’s requirements.

PCB Design Process Description
Schematic Design Create a graphical representation of the electronic circuit using EDA software
Component Placement Arrange components on the PCB layout in a logical and efficient manner
Routing Create conductive paths on the PCB to connect components
Design Rule Check (DRC) Verify that the PCB layout meets manufacturing constraints and design rules
Gerber File Generation Generate industry-standard files for PCB fabrication
PCB Manufacturing Process Description
PCB Fabrication Create the physical PCB using photolithography, etching, drilling, plating, and finishing processes
PCB Assembly Mount components onto the PCB using through-hole or surface mount techniques
Quality Control Perform visual, automated, and electrical inspections to ensure proper functionality and reliability

By understanding the PCB design and manufacturing processes, you can create custom PCBs that bring your electronic projects to life. Happy designing and manufacturing!